Output 64647b0867550c234bbea04ec6ca372805414036fafaf9f7d19d7fa24d9727cb:21

value
472577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f1cef285fb52806a88aa52ec4fdeaa21c52023 OP_EQUAL
address
3MeguWCAUh8eW1NrwNsKd2VbkomDgJk9GC
transaction
64647b0867550c234bbea04ec6ca372805414036fafaf9f7d19d7fa24d9727cb
spent
true